WebJun 21, 2024 · Beans, peas and lentils are all legumes and are among the most versatile and nutritious foods available. Legumes are typically low in fat and high in fiber, folate, potassium, iron and magnesium. WebA food item is considered high in fiber if the fiber content is over 5g. A (1/2 Cup Serving) Navy Beans contains about 6.7 g of fiber.
